[HarmonyPatch]
public static class PesticideReworkPatches
{
	public static float TurbochargeRangeMultiplier = 2f;

	public static float MissingHealthDamageMultiplier = 1.25f;

	[HarmonyPatch(typeof(BounceShotgun), "OnUpgradesEnabled")]
	[HarmonyPostfix]
	public static void OnUpgradesEnabledPostfix(BounceShotgun __instance)
	{
		//IL_00af: Unknown result type (might be due to invalid IL or missing references)
		//IL_00b9: Expected O, but got Unknown
		//IL_00b9: Unknown result type (might be due to invalid IL or missing references)
		//IL_00c3: Expected O, but got Unknown
		if (!SparrohPlugin.enablePesticideRework.Value || !(__instance.ShotgunData.flamethrowerRange > 0f))
		{
			return;
		}
		bool flag = false;
		foreach (UpgradeInstance activeUpgrade in ((Gun)__instance).ActiveUpgrades)
		{
			if (activeUpgrade.IsTurbocharged && (activeUpgrade.Upgrade.Name.Contains("Pesticide") || activeUpgrade.Upgrade.Name.Contains("Flamethrower")))
			{
				flag = true;
				break;
			}
		}
		if (flag)
		{
			__instance.ShotgunData.flamethrowerRange *= TurbochargeRangeMultiplier;
		}
		((Gun)__instance).OnBeforeDamage = (MutableDamageCallback)Delegate.Combine((Delegate?)(object)((Gun)__instance).OnBeforeDamage, (Delegate?)new MutableDamageCallback(OnBeforeFlamethrowerDamage));
	}

	[HarmonyPatch(typeof(BounceShotgun), "OnUpgradesDisabled")]
	[HarmonyPostfix]
	public static void OnUpgradesDisabledPostfix(BounceShotgun __instance)
	{
		//IL_002c: Unknown result type (might be due to invalid IL or missing references)
		//IL_0036: Expected O, but got Unknown
		//IL_0036: Unknown result type (might be due to invalid IL or missing references)
		//IL_0040: Expected O, but got Unknown
		if (SparrohPlugin.enablePesticideRework.Value && __instance.ShotgunData.flamethrowerRange > 0f)
		{
			((Gun)__instance).OnBeforeDamage = (MutableDamageCallback)Delegate.Remove((Delegate?)(object)((Gun)__instance).OnBeforeDamage, (Delegate?)new MutableDamageCallback(OnBeforeFlamethrowerDamage));
		}
	}

	private static void OnBeforeFlamethrowerDamage(ref DamageCallbackData data)
	{
		//IL_0006: Unknown result type (might be due to invalid IL or missing references)
		//IL_000d: Unknown result type (might be due to invalid IL or missing references)
		//IL_0010: Invalid comparison between Unknown and I4
		if ((data.damageData.damageFlags & 0x11) != 17)
		{
			return;
		}
		IDamageSource source = data.source;
		BounceShotgun val = (BounceShotgun)(object)((source is BounceShotgun) ? source : null);
		if (val == null)
		{
			return;
		}
		bool flag = false;
		foreach (UpgradeInstance activeUpgrade in ((Gun)val).ActiveUpgrades)
		{
			if (activeUpgrade.IsTurbocharged && (activeUpgrade.Upgrade.Name.Contains("Pesticide") || activeUpgrade.Upgrade.Name.Contains("Flamethrower")))
			{
				flag = true;
				break;
			}
		}
		if (flag)
		{
			float num = 1f - ((ISelectable)data.target).Health / data.target.MaxHealth;
			data.damageData.damage *= 1f + num * MissingHealthDamageMultiplier;
		}
	}
}
[BepInPlugin("sparroh.pesticiderework", "PesticideRework", "1.0.1")]
[MycoMod(/*Could not decode attribute arguments.*/)]
public class SparrohPlugin : BaseUnityPlugin
{
	public const string PluginGUID = "sparroh.pesticiderework";

	public const string PluginName = "PesticideRework";

	public const string PluginVersion = "1.0.1";

	internal static ManualLogSource Logger;

	internal static ConfigEntry<bool> enablePesticideRework;

	private Harmony harmony;

	private void Awake()
	{
		//IL_0031: Unknown result type (might be due to invalid IL or missing references)
		//IL_003b: Expected O, but got Unknown
		Logger = ((BaseUnityPlugin)this).Logger;
		enablePesticideRework = ((BaseUnityPlugin)this).Config.Bind<bool>("General", "Enable Pesticide Rework", true, "Enhances Pesticide flamethrower with turbocharged range boost and damage scaling with enemy missing health.");
		harmony = new Harmony("sparroh.pesticiderework");
		harmony.PatchAll(typeof(PesticideReworkPatches));
		Logger.LogInfo((object)"PesticideRework v1.0.1 loaded successfully.");
	}

	private void OnDestroy()
	{
		Harmony obj = harmony;
		if (obj != null)
		{
			obj.UnpatchSelf();
		}
	}
}
